## Ownership: Log Compaction

The Quillbus message queue runs log compaction every six hours to reclaim segment space while preserving the latest value per key. As a new contractor, please do not adjust compaction thresholds or retention windows without review — mis-tuned settings have previously caused consumer lag spikes in the Ledgerline pipeline. All compaction config changes must go through a tracked change request. Questions, escalations, and approvals should be directed to the owner named below.

account owner for bawip-tahag: Raleth Quenok

## ProfileVault Environments

ProfileVault shards the user-profile store across four partitions in staging and sixteen in production. Shard assignment is hash-based on account ID, so rebalancing only happens during planned resharding windows. If you're on call and see hot-shard alerts, check the partition map before touching anything — most pages resolve to a single overloaded shard. The active shard configuration for production is as follows.

settings of hahag-taweg:
[jorius]
team = gilox
access_code = ac_b64218
host = jorius.zarqelstack.example
port = 8080
owner = quenath.briax
peer = eliix.halixcloud.corp

**Ticket: Proctorline vault won't open**

Welcome, new folks — first fun surprise: the credentials vault for Proctorline, our exam-proctoring queue, locked itself after three bad attempts by a misconfigured deploy job. Until it's unsealed, the queue workers can't fetch session tokens and proctoring requests just pile up. Fix is easy: run the unseal script from the ops box and enter the recovery passphrase listed below.

vault phrase of bagaf-kajeg = jorath-feniel-briir-siliel-ralix

Ticket: Missed pick-up — exhibition loan return. The courier from Askett Freight did not arrive Tuesday to collect the six framed pieces on loan from the Herrindale Gallery for the "Quiet Rivers" show. Items remain crated in the secure store, condition reports attached. Records team: log the missed slot and confirm the rescheduled collection for Thursday morning. When the courier arrives, follow the hand-over instruction below precisely.

dispatch memo: the lamwyn fenwyn courier leaves the wenir ledger at gate 7175 under passcode 822969